The Role of Risk Tolerance and Bankroll Management

Effective plinko gameplay isn’t solely about maximizing your chances of winning; it’s also about managing your risk and protecting your bankroll. A crucial aspect of this is determining your risk tolerance – how much are you willing to lose in pursuit of a larger prize? Players with a high-risk tolerance might be comfortable betting larger amounts and aiming for the top prize, while those with a lower risk tolerance might prefer to make smaller bets and play a more conservative game. Understanding your own risk tolerance is the first step toward responsible plinko play.

Bankroll management is equally important. Set a budget for your plinko sessions and stick to it. Avoid chasing losses, and don’t bet more than you can afford to lose. A sensible approach is to divide your bankroll into smaller units and bet a fixed percentage of your bankroll on each drop. This helps to mitigate the impact of losing streaks and extend your overall playtime. Furthermore, establish win limits; knowing when to quit while you’re ahead is just as vital as knowing when to stop after incurring losses.
